| /freebsd/contrib/llvm-project/llvm/include/llvm/Support/ |
| H A D | TrailingObjects.h | 88 template <typename T> struct OverloadToken {}; struct 146 TrailingObjectsBase::OverloadToken<NextTy>) { in getTrailingObjectsImpl() 148 Obj, TrailingObjectsBase::OverloadToken<PrevTy>()) + in getTrailingObjectsImpl() 150 Obj, TrailingObjectsBase::OverloadToken<PrevTy>()); in getTrailingObjectsImpl() 161 TrailingObjectsBase::OverloadToken<NextTy>) { in getTrailingObjectsImpl() 163 Obj, TrailingObjectsBase::OverloadToken<PrevTy>()) + in getTrailingObjectsImpl() 165 Obj, TrailingObjectsBase::OverloadToken<PrevTy>()); in getTrailingObjectsImpl() 248 TrailingObjectsBase::OverloadToken<BaseTy>) { in getTrailingObjectsImpl() 254 TrailingObjectsBase::OverloadToken<BaseTy>) { in getTrailingObjectsImpl() 267 TrailingObjectsBase::OverloadToken<BaseTy>) { in callNumTrailingObjects() [all …]
|
| /freebsd/contrib/llvm-project/clang/include/clang/AST/ |
| H A D | ExprOpenMP.h | 50 unsigned numTrailingObjects(OverloadToken<Expr *>) const { in numTrailingObjects() 55 unsigned numTrailingObjects(OverloadToken<SourceRange>) const { in numTrailingObjects() 220 unsigned numTrailingObjects(OverloadToken<Decl *>) const { in numTrailingObjects() 224 unsigned numTrailingObjects(OverloadToken<Expr *>) const { in numTrailingObjects() 228 unsigned numTrailingObjects(OverloadToken<SourceLocation>) const { in numTrailingObjects()
|
| H A D | ExprCXX.h | 452 unsigned numTrailingObjects(OverloadToken<CXXBaseSpecifier *>) const { in numTrailingObjects() 1840 unsigned numTrailingObjects(OverloadToken<CXXBaseSpecifier *>) const { in numTrailingObjects() 2376 unsigned numTrailingObjects(OverloadToken<Stmt *>) const { in numTrailingObjects() 2380 unsigned numTrailingObjects(OverloadToken<SourceRange>) const { in numTrailingObjects() 2577 return raw_arg_begin() + numTrailingObjects(OverloadToken<Stmt *>()); in raw_arg_end() 2583 return raw_arg_begin() + numTrailingObjects(OverloadToken<Stmt *>()); in raw_arg_end() 2889 size_t numTrailingObjects(OverloadToken<TypeSourceInfo *>) const { in numTrailingObjects() 2893 size_t numTrailingObjects(OverloadToken<APValue>) const { in numTrailingObjects() 3363 unsigned numTrailingObjects(OverloadToken<DeclAccessPair>) const { in numTrailingObjects() 3367 unsigned numTrailingObjects(OverloadToken<ASTTemplateKWAndArgsInfo>) const { in numTrailingObjects() [all …]
|
| H A D | OpenMPClause.h | 2618 size_t numTrailingObjects(OverloadToken<SourceLocation>) const { in numTrailingObjects() 3830 size_t numTrailingObjects(OverloadToken<Expr *>) const { in numTrailingObjects() 3835 size_t numTrailingObjects(OverloadToken<bool>) const { in numTrailingObjects() 6432 size_t numTrailingObjects(OverloadToken<Expr *>) const { in numTrailingObjects() 6437 size_t numTrailingObjects(OverloadToken<ValueDecl *>) const { in numTrailingObjects() 6440 size_t numTrailingObjects(OverloadToken<unsigned>) const { in numTrailingObjects() 7555 size_t numTrailingObjects(OverloadToken<Expr *>) const { in numTrailingObjects() 7560 size_t numTrailingObjects(OverloadToken<ValueDecl *>) const { in numTrailingObjects() 7563 size_t numTrailingObjects(OverloadToken<unsigned>) const { in numTrailingObjects() 7756 size_t numTrailingObjects(OverloadToken<Expr *>) const { in numTrailingObjects() [all …]
|
| H A D | Expr.h | 1088 size_t numTrailingObjects(OverloadToken<APValue>) const { in numTrailingObjects() 1091 size_t numTrailingObjects(OverloadToken<uint64_t>) const { in numTrailingObjects() 1280 size_t numTrailingObjects(OverloadToken<NestedNameSpecifierLoc>) const { in numTrailingObjects() 1284 size_t numTrailingObjects(OverloadToken<NamedDecl *>) const { in numTrailingObjects() 1288 size_t numTrailingObjects(OverloadToken<ASTTemplateKWAndArgsInfo>) const { in numTrailingObjects() 1815 unsigned numTrailingObjects(OverloadToken<unsigned>) const { return 1; } in numTrailingObjects() 1816 unsigned numTrailingObjects(OverloadToken<SourceLocation>) const { in numTrailingObjects() 1820 unsigned numTrailingObjects(OverloadToken<char>) const { in numTrailingObjects() 2534 size_t numTrailingObjects(OverloadToken<OffsetOfNode>) const { in numTrailingObjects() 3306 size_t numTrailingObjects(OverloadToken<NestedNameSpecifierLoc>) const { in numTrailingObjects() [all …]
|
| H A D | Stmt.h | 1753 size_t numTrailingObjects(OverloadToken<Stmt *>) const { 1952 unsigned numTrailingObjects(OverloadToken<Stmt *>) const { 2071 numTrailingObjects(OverloadToken<Stmt *>())); 2077 numTrailingObjects(OverloadToken<Stmt *>())); 2292 unsigned numTrailingObjects(OverloadToken<Stmt *>) const { 2297 unsigned numTrailingObjects(OverloadToken<SourceLocation>) const { 2493 numTrailingObjects(OverloadToken<Stmt *>())); 2502 numTrailingObjects(OverloadToken<Stmt *>()));
|
| H A D | StmtOpenACC.h | 507 size_t numTrailingObjects(OverloadToken<Expr *>) const { return NumExprs; } in numTrailingObjects() 508 size_t numTrailingObjects(OverloadToken<const OpenACCClause *>) const { in numTrailingObjects()
|
| H A D | ExprConcepts.h | 514 unsigned numTrailingObjects(OverloadToken<ParmVarDecl *>) const { in numTrailingObjects()
|
| H A D | Type.h | 3378 unsigned numTrailingObjects(OverloadToken<TypeCoupledDeclRefInfo>) const { 5315 unsigned numTrailingObjects(OverloadToken<QualType>) const { 5319 unsigned numTrailingObjects(OverloadToken<SourceLocation>) const { 5323 unsigned numTrailingObjects(OverloadToken<FunctionTypeArmAttributes>) const { 5327 unsigned numTrailingObjects(OverloadToken<FunctionTypeExtraBitfields>) const { 5331 unsigned numTrailingObjects(OverloadToken<ExceptionType>) const { 5335 unsigned numTrailingObjects(OverloadToken<Expr *>) const { 5339 unsigned numTrailingObjects(OverloadToken<FunctionDecl *>) const { 5343 unsigned numTrailingObjects(OverloadToken<ExtParameterInfo>) const { 5347 unsigned numTrailingObjects(OverloadToken<Qualifiers>) const { [all …]
|
| H A D | StmtCXX.h | 76 size_t numTrailingObjects(OverloadToken<Stmt *>) const { return NumHandlers; } in numTrailingObjects()
|
| H A D | ExprObjC.h | 337 size_t numTrailingObjects(OverloadToken<KeyValuePair>) const { in numTrailingObjects() 1045 size_t numTrailingObjects(OverloadToken<void *>) const { return NumArgs + 1; } in numTrailingObjects()
|
| H A D | DeclTemplate.h | 106 size_t numTrailingObjects(OverloadToken<NamedDecl *>) const { in numTrailingObjects() 110 size_t numTrailingObjects(OverloadToken<Expr *>) const { in numTrailingObjects() 1386 OverloadToken<std::pair<QualType, TypeSourceInfo *>>) const {
|
| H A D | OpenACCClause.h | 673 size_t numTrailingObjects(OverloadToken<Expr *>) const { in numTrailingObjects()
|
| H A D | Decl.h | 2012 size_t numTrailingObjects(OverloadToken<DeclAccessPair>) const { in numTrailingObjects() 4854 size_t numTrailingObjects(OverloadToken<ImplicitParamDecl>) { in numTrailingObjects()
|
| H A D | DeclCXX.h | 2618 size_t numTrailingObjects(OverloadToken<InheritedConstructor>) const { in numTrailingObjects()
|
| /freebsd/contrib/llvm-project/clang/include/clang/Sema/ |
| H A D | ParsedAttr.h | 122 size_t numTrailingObjects(OverloadToken<ArgsUnion>) const { return NumArgs; } in numTrailingObjects() 123 size_t numTrailingObjects(OverloadToken<detail::AvailabilityData>) const { in numTrailingObjects() 127 numTrailingObjects(OverloadToken<detail::TypeTagForDatatypeData>) const { in numTrailingObjects() 130 size_t numTrailingObjects(OverloadToken<ParsedType>) const { in numTrailingObjects()
|
| /freebsd/contrib/llvm-project/llvm/include/llvm/CodeGen/ |
| H A D | MachineInstr.h | 259 size_t numTrailingObjects(OverloadToken<MachineMemOperand *>) const { in numTrailingObjects() 262 size_t numTrailingObjects(OverloadToken<MCSymbol *>) const { in numTrailingObjects() 265 size_t numTrailingObjects(OverloadToken<MDNode *>) const { in numTrailingObjects() 268 size_t numTrailingObjects(OverloadToken<uint32_t>) const { in numTrailingObjects()
|
| /freebsd/contrib/llvm-project/clang/include/clang/CodeGen/ |
| H A D | CGFunctionInfo.h | 667 size_t numTrailingObjects(OverloadToken<ArgInfo>) const { in numTrailingObjects() 670 size_t numTrailingObjects(OverloadToken<ExtParameterInfo>) const { in numTrailingObjects()
|
| /freebsd/contrib/llvm-project/llvm/include/llvm/TableGen/ |
| H A D | Record.h | 1431 size_t numTrailingObjects(OverloadToken<const Init *>) const { in numTrailingObjects()
|